Hacker News new | ask | show | jobs
by thiago_fm 1860 days ago
Hey,

Can I suggest the obvious? Therapy. We developers try to believe that everything that goes through us is rational, but it could be that unprocessed emotions are clouding your mind and making things harder for you. A Therapist might have trouble with computers but understands emotions very well and might help you to understand what you want and what really bothers you.

It is very hard to go through this alone and they can be the helping hand for us. If you have very good relationship with your family, partner or friends, that can be helpful as well, as long as it is positive and you feel heard. It is normal to also hit roadblocks and end up in a similar situation as you, having the right support should help you to cross this path.

Another thing I've noticed is that you have a big tendency to depreciate yourself and have extremely high expectations for you. Leetcode problems are hard and many trival things(like remembering how to calculate a median) isn't something everybody remember. You don't need to know it all. Also to receive a salary you don't need to be the very best of your field, you just need to do some work and your part. We aren't robots.

I am also having a hard time during the pandemic, if you feel like talking feel free to reach me out. I actually envy a lot C++ devs and their flags even though I know "cloud computing" ;-).